Benow acquires a digital payment start-up, Finmo

Digital payments company Benow, has acquired Gurgaon-based Finmo and their flagship product DigiBharat with immediate effect in a cash and stocks deal. All existing 500+ merchants acquired by Finmo will be on-boarded as Benow merchants, over the next few weeks.
Commenting on the acquisition, Sudhakar Ram, Founder and CEO, Benow says, “We strongly believe that acquiring Finmo will help us strengthen our base in the industry and in turn increase our merchant and customer base deeper in India. Finmo also has a strong entrepreneurial team that understands the payment space in India, adding to Benow’s talent base. As a combined entity, we have the capability and momentum to become a leader in enabling neighborhood merchants to accept digital payments”.
Chirag Saini, Co-Founder, Finmo, further adds, “Joining forces with Benow makes us more competent to achieve the goal of a less cash India. Benow founding team’s depth of experience will help us achieve great things ahead.”
